Comcast entered spin control mode on Monday after an Associated Press story revealed that the cable company limits access to BitTorrent and other file-sharing networks. AP reported Friday that Comcast "aggressively" interrupts peer-to-peer file uploads by sending "TCP reset packets" that appear to be coming from the user's computer.
